Five Guys Burgers and Fries is interviewing for crew members. Ranked #1 burger in America, not only for our delicious food but also for our exceptional employees.
We have a unique work environment and open kitchen design. From the register, to the grill, to morning prep and evening close, our employees work as a team in all areas of the restaurant.
We also have a unique bonus program, called the Secret Shopper program, which offers cash bonuses for upholding high standards and delivering an outstanding dining experience.
Our restaurants are lively, with lots of team communication and classic rock music playing. You're encouraged to sing along!
Family owned, we focus on fresh ingredients, food safety, cleanliness, and customer service. No freezers are used in our restaurants.
